Every household to receive food aid

KUCHING: Demak Laut assemblyman Dr Hazland Abang Hipni yesterday assured that no household would miss out on the state food aid. In the first phase, the recipients are heads of households listed under the eKasih system, which is Malaysia’s national poverty database system developed by the government in 2008 to centralise data on impoverished households […]

RM174,600 for longhouse victims

SIBU: Residents of the 22-door Rh Dingon Megong, a longhouse at Sekuau Resettlement Scheme which was destroyed in a fire on Feb 10, yesterday received assistance from the Sarawak Social Welfare Department (JKM).   The total donation of RM174,600 was handed over by Minister of Welfare, Community Wellbeing, Women, Family and Childhood Development Datuk Seri Fatimah Abdullah.
